Annual Awards Ceremony: Hollis Police Department Honors Agency Members and Community Members/Swears-In Newest Officer

June, 28, 2022
HPD

“The best part of being a public servant and law enforcement executive is taking time to recognize the incredible work of your teammates.” Chief Joe Hoebeke

Hollis Police Chief Joe Hoebeke presided over the annual police department awards ceremony, held at Lawrence Barn Tuesday afternoon. Select Board and town officials, members of the police and fire departments, family members and townspeople attended the gathering sharing smiles and laughter, handshakes and hugs.

Chief Hoebeke prefaced the presentation with his belief that “[t]he men and women of the Hollis Police Department constitute the very best of the policing profession. They are compassionate, hardworking, professional, dedicated, and selfless servants who place the safety of our community before that of their own. Moreover, they consistently demonstrate the honor and nobility of the policing profession.”
